Write about any three uses of silk.

संक्षेप में उत्तर
Advertisements

उत्तर

  1. Silk has natural beauty and elegance.
  2. It gives comfort in warm weather and warmth during colder months.
  3. It is used in the manufacture of classical and high fashion clothes, modern dresses particularly silk sarees, the elegant of beautiful dresses.
  4. It is also used in household for making wall hangings, curtains, rugs and carpets.
  5. It is also being used in the manufacture of surgical threads for sutures.
